Registriert seit: 17. Jul 2005
885 Beiträge
Delphi 11 Alexandria
|
Re: Laptop spezial Tasten
7. Jan 2007, 15:42
@Robert: Hast du da genauere Informationen zu? Ich hatte da mal Probleme bei meinem MP3-Player, da dieser Service scheinbar nicht auf jedem System läuft, so dass die Tastendrücke manchmal nicht registriert werden, wenn meine Anwendung nicht den Fokus hat.
Ich habe dann WM_APPCOMMAND gehooked, was natürlich schiefläuft, wenn dieser Service doch läuft, da dann jeder Tastendruck mehrfach bei meiner Anwendung ankommt. Gelöst habe ich das so, dass beim ersten registrierten WM_APPCOMMAND ein kleiner interaktiver Test durchgeführt wird, ob dieser Service läuft oder nicht und dementsprechend ab dann der Hook installiert wird oder nicht.
Optimal ist das nicht. Wenn du da Näheres zu weißt, würde mich das brennend interessieren!
|